The Lake View Wildcats came up short against the Prosser Falcons on Friday, falling 36-14. The Wildcats have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Treyshaun Strong was a one-man wrecking crew For Prosser. as he rushed for 159 yards and three TDs on only 11 carries, and also picked up 78 receiving yards and one touchdown. Strong really tore up the turf during one magnificent 88-yard run.
Lake View's loss dropped their record down to 2-2. As for Prosser,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 3-1.
Lake View w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next matchup, a 44-41 defeat against North Lawndale on the 27th. As for Prosser,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next game, a 44-14 victory against Chicago Sullivan on the 26th.
